πŸ‘ Match Report πŸ‘ Laois 2s v Muckross 09/12/2023

Laois HC2s travelled to Muckross on Saturday 9th December. Numbers were a bit depleted as some of the players were still carrying injuries from the Portrane game a few weeks ago.

We weren’t sure what the afternoon would bring with the orange wind warning alerts all over the M50 on the trip up. Laois lost the toss and had to play against the wind in the first half and it was blowing us and the ball all over the field. A lot of mishit passes as the ball was just blown away from the stick.

However, they soon settled into the game with a goal in the first quarter coming from centre forward, Shauna Walsh. Another goal came early in the second quarter from Faye Delaney who covered an awful lot of ground during the match. Evana had a few unlucky wides but was well positioned on the left post throughout.

We had the wind at our backs in the second half thankfully and Penny Wilkinson carried the ball herself from midfield and scored a great goal in the third quarter. Evana Cassidy had an unfortunate clash of heads and had to come off in the third quarter with concussion.

Faye Delaney added to the final tally with a lovely tomahawk in the last quarter. There was great defensive positioning by newcomer Lily Van den Bergh and Mikayla Lahart worked really hard in midfield to keep the pressure on Muckross. Laois had to defend a number of short corners in the last quarter but defended well to keep Muckross out.

Laois finished the match 4-0. Well done to everyone for a great away win in difficult conditions.

We look forward to our next match against Malahide on Saturday December 16th which will be the last match before Christmas.
